Compact Design

Foldable treadmills are small enough to fit under a bed or into a closet when not in use, but still provide plenty of running space. The treadmills that fold are usually less expensive than non-folding treadmills and can aid in keeping you active on days where the weather isn't ideal or when you have a busy schedule.

Be aware of your fitness goals and the way you plan to use the treadmill. Some treadmills are made for walking, whereas others allow light jogging or even short runs. Before purchasing a treadmill, make sure to check the speed range and size.

Non-folding treadmill incline treadmills tend to be much heavier, which allows them to remain stable even at high speeds. However, they also have a design which can make them less sturdy particularly when they are used by runners who push themselves to the max. When choosing a treadmill that folds, look for one that comes with safety features, like an emergency stop button, to ensure that you can easily stop it if you accidentally lose control of the machine.

If you want to purchase a foldable treadmill with incline treadmill that is safe for runners pick one that has a strong motor and a large deck size. In general, the 2.5 horsepower motor is adequate for casual runners and occasional sprinters however serious runners should look for at least 3.5 hp to ensure they can run comfortably at high speeds. Also, consider treadmills with cushioning built-in to minimize the impact on your knees so that you can train for long periods of time without fearing injury.

Convenient Storage

If you live in a tiny space, you should be able to fold up your treadmill when being used. Most treadmills that fold are equipped with wheels, which means they can be easily removed to make space for other activities. For example, when your kids arrive home from school or your guests arrive later. Non-folding models typically require more space because they are built to be permanent fixtures in your home.

While a lot of treadmills that fold are designed for smaller spaces, they don't skimp on features or performance. The NordicTrack Commercial 1750 treadmill, for example, folds up quickly thanks to an exclusive EasyLift mechanism. This treadmill has a 3.5 CHP engine, and the 15% incline and an 3% decline.

Another option is the SF-T7632 folding treadmill from Sunny Health & Fitness. It can be put in a closet, or under a table and it also has an incredibly comfortable running deck. Its small size and sturdy construction make it a good option for those looking to get some light exercise while working or watching TV.

If you're considering buying a foldable treadmill make sure you read the description of the product for specifics on how it can be folded up and stored. You should also examine the frame's dimensions and weight and also the added transport features, such as transportation wheels and carry handles built-in.

Safety

When selecting a treadmill fold up, be sure that it is equipped with security features. Most folding treadmills come with an safety lock to keep the deck in place when in storage mode. This feature protects the deck from being released accidentally when the machine is used. It also helps keep children from being around the machine.

Another crucial security feature to look out for is a lock on the power cord. This will ensure that the treadmill has been turned off and is out of reach at the conclusion of every workout. This is particularly crucial if you have children who might be enticed by the temptation to turn on the treadmill or play with the cords. If the treadmill isn't properly secured and shut off after every use the treadmill might be able to be turned on accidentally. Or children could pull the cord, causing it to speed up.

Also, make sure that the treadmill is placed away from things like drapes or curtains that could inadvertently hang down close to the treadmill while you are using it. This could result in the risk of slipping and increases the risk of sustaining injuries. It is also recommended that you use a treadmill in the correct footwear. This will reduce the risk of falling and tripping over your house's objects and will also assist you maintain a steady stride when running or walking on the treadmill.
